Developing Engaging Android Apps for a Global Audience

Crafting engaging Android apps for a global audience requires careful consideration of various factors. A key aspect is to grasp the diverse cultural norms and user preferences that exist across different regions.

Customization of content, features and even app design can significantly boost user engagement. For instance, using relevant imagery and language that resonates with the target audience is crucial.

Furthermore, it's important to ensure a seamless user experience by fine-tuning the app for different screen sizes.

By meeting these factors, developers can develop Android apps that are both interesting and successful in a global market.
